In Pamukkale, it’s your choice. Spend the afternoon soaking in the Cleopatra Antique Pools, fed by thermal spring waters that fill a section of the ancient city. Bathe amongst old columns and ancient paving stones from the Roman times, a truly unique experience. If you’d prefer to stay dry, take a tour of ancient Pamukkale and explore the vast archeological site with your Tour Manager via golf cart. The tour includes the ancient Roman Theatre as well as an opportunity to visit the site’s Museum. Whichever you choose, all will have free time to visit the site’s natural “Cotton Candy” pools as well.
Enjoy a pause of luxury at a historic Istanbul Hammam, your ticket into the legendary Turkish bath culture. When you arrive, don your pestemal – a traditional wrap used to cover your body. Start in the “hot” room, where you will relax and loosen your muscles. This is followed by a foam bath and scrubbing – resulting in a deep-cleaning experience that will leave your skin at its most pure. Relax in the aftermath of your glowing skin and enjoy this world-renowned practice.

The overall activity level of this tour is a level 3. This means walking and standing for longer periods of time (2-3 hours) isn’t a big deal for you. You can navigate hills and uneven ground, climb into various modes of transportation (tuk-tuk, cable car, zodiac, etc.), and could possibly anticipate changes in elevation. Walking four miles over a course of a day is very doable as is climbing 3 flights of stairs. You can handle altitudes between 6,000 and 9,000 feet. You can expect some full days balanced with free-time. This level is not a fit for travelers that require mobility assistance devices. This program includes several early-morning departures and full day transfers. In particular, on the day you travel from Istanbul to Canakkale, you will depart the hotel in Istanbul at 7:30 a.m. to beat the city’s legendary traffic and travel a distance of over 210 miles (340 km). Additional longest driving days you will experience on this tour are when you will drive 205 miles (325 km) from Çanakkale to Izmir and from Daylan to Konya when you will drive a distance of 346 miles (557 km).
Some of the most unique sightseeing can mean accessing locations that restrict motor coaches, especially in historic areas such as Istanbul’s Golden Horn district, the town of Dalyan and the archeological sites of Pergamon, Ephesus, Pamukkale, and Kaunos. In particular, the sightseeing in Istanbul requires a minimum of 2 miles (3.2 km) of walking per day. You will be walking over cobblestoned streets with narrow sidewalks, at times uphill. The archeological sites of Pergamon, Ephesus, Kaunos and in Cappadocia, your itinerary includes many activities that require walking on uneven, unpaved terrain, often with loose stones. Visiting sites such as the Underground City and the Göreme Open-Air Museum require climbing and descending steep staircases and/or ramps with limited to no help from handrails. Some of these visits may not be suitable for people who suffer from claustrophobia. Agility is required for boarding the boats for your included tours. For your comfort, we recommend bringing sturdy walking shoes. If you require a walker or wheelchair, or have difficulty walking, you will not be able to access some of these areas and may want to consider an alternate program with us.
